An Environmental Science job involves studying the environment and finding solutions to issues such as pollution, conservation, and sustainability. Professionals in this field work in various sectors, including government agencies, research institutions, and private companies, to assess environmental impact and develop strategies for improvement. Common roles include environmental consultant, scientist, specialist, or engineer, focusing on areas like water quality, climate change, and natural resource management. These jobs require data analysis, fieldwork, and collaboration with policymakers or organizations to implement environmental solutions. A degree in environmental science or a related field is typically required.
Environmental science professionals commonly work on projects such as conducting environmental impact assessments, collecting and analyzing soil, water, or air samples, and developing sustainability plans for organizations or communities. They may also collaborate with policy makers, engineers, and local agencies to design solutions that address pollution or resource management challenges. Daily tasks often involve both fieldwork and data analysis, with some roles requiring report writing or presenting findings to stakeholders. These diverse responsibilities provide opportunities to develop specialized expertise and contribute to meaningful environmental improvements.
To thrive in Environmental Science, a strong background in biology, chemistry, and ecology—often supported by a relevant degree—is essential. Familiarity with data analysis software, geographic information systems (GIS), and field sampling equipment is typically required, and certifications like HAZWOPER can be advantageous. Strong analytical thinking, communication, and teamwork skills help professionals interpret data and collaborate on environmental solutions. These abilities are crucial for effectively addressing environmental issues and making informed recommendations that impact public health and policy.

Tetra Tech is adding an Environmental Scientist to our field team based in Germantown, Md, with field work locations primarily in Frederick, Carroll and Baltimore counties. This position requires the employee to be a U.S. Citizen due to the projects they will be working on.

Your Role :
This position will provide mid-level geologist or scientist support to various environmental assessment/remediation projects. Work includes due diligence work, report preparation, and various environmental field work. Field work and travel is estimated to be 75%. Capable of assuming responsibility for routine to complex tasks/projects. Experience in leading field crews is desirable.
Assume lead and supporting technical role for projects.
Record field data, write reports, generate figures and tables, manage data.
Perform Phase I and II ESAs.
Conduct environmental due diligence and perform Investigations at CERCLA, RCRA, and other impacted sites.
Collect soil and water samples using various sampling techniques (soil, sediment, groundwater surface water, waste)
Plan and coordinate directly with subcontractors and field personnel.
Assume supporting roles in proposals and marketing.
Work in a safe manner at all times and report all health and safety incidents and concerns.
Other duties as be assigned.
Qualifications:
Bachelor's degree (BA/BS) in geology or environmental science is required, Master's degree (MS/MA) a plus, but not required.
1-3 years directly related professional experience and/or training in environmental assessment/remediation related work required
Stormwater pollution prevention compliance experience, a plus
Erosion and Sediment Control compliance inspection experience, a plus
Willingness and ability to perform field work at various locations, approximately 75%.
40-hour HazWoper Certification preferred. Ability to obtain certification within 90-days, required.

The physical demands of field activities include:
Sampling work may include lifting, maneuvering, positioning, and operating sampling/testing equipment (pumps, hoses, power cables, hand augers, sampling tools, etc.).
Operation of field equipment and movement over rough terrain.
Traversing and remaining motionless for long periods of time
Ability to lift up to 60 lbs
Work Environment: The work environment characteristics described here are representative of those an employee encounters while performing the essential functions of this job. Reasonable accommodations may be made to enable individuals with disabilities to perform the essential functions.
Project work will entail a mix of office work and field work. Office work will be in a typical office environment with controlled conditions. Field work will entail work in a wide range of outdoor conditions, including work in adverse weather conditions, such as high heat, extreme cold, and precipitation and on unimproved job sites where dense vegetation, uneven ground, and physical obstacles may be present. Project worksites will typically be within the eastern United States but may include travel to/work at sites across the United States and internationally. Field project durations may range from one day to several weeks.
